**Q: How do I bulk-edit rows in the Pinefort admin table?**

Select rows with the checkboxes, then hit the pencil icon in the toolbar — changes apply to every selected row at once, so double-check before saving. There's no undo yet (it's on the roadmap, promise). If a bulk edit goes sideways and you need a restore from snapshot, email the data-ops folks.

escalation mailbox, bafog-fafog: ulador@paliqlabs.internal

**Q: Why did the Tidewell cron jobs drift by several minutes last quarter?**

A: The Tidewell scheduler synced against a decommissioned time source, accumulating roughly four seconds of drift per day. The fix lives in the chrony overlay; do not revert it. If you must reopen the sealed investigation archive, it is encrypted, and the recovery passphrase needed to open it appears below.

strongbox words: zorwyn-sorael-belion-ulaius-silmir-ulays-briax-rusdor-gorix

## Changelog — Driftbarn v2.4

Heads up for anyone new: we renamed `PARTITION_MODE` to `PARTITION_INTERVAL` since the old name confused everyone. Tables now partition by month out of the box, so the archiver job runs way faster. Update your local env file accordingly — old name is ignored as of this release. The partition manager also needs its signing credential to rotate monthly segments, so add that line right after the interval setting.

env line for fafof-fahag: LEDGER_TOKEN5=f8790

Severity: Medium. The credentials vault that external plugin authors use to sign Clueline crossword-generator extensions locked itself after three failed rotation attempts on Tuesday. Until it's reopened, new plugin builds cannot be signed, though previously signed plugins continue to load normally. We've confirmed the vault hardware is healthy and the lockout is purely software-side. Per the recovery runbook, an on-call maintainer must reopen it by entering the recovery passphrase below.

unlock words, yawig-kagef: gordor-holvan-ulaael-pramir-ulaiel-tamdor